CRASH

3200 HACKATHORN LANE: A 60-year-old man was ticketed after accidentally driving his 2003 Jaguar into a building while attempting to park Tuesday morning, Undersheriff Quentin Reynolds said. The man told deputies that he had hit the wrong pedal due to medical bandages on his foot, which caused the car to move forward. No injuries were reported but damages are estimated at more than $1,000, and the building’s owner, a 54-year-old man, being informed of the incident. The 60-year-old man was ticketed for failing to provide proof of insurance.
